Version 1.3.7 is now available on the "public_beta" branch.

There are some significant changes to note with this update. Firstly, we will no longer reset your settings with every update.

Secondly, we have changed the way the game writes to and reads configuration files within the [Spintires/Users/] directory.

Within [Spintires/Users] directory, you will see the following new files.

  • BaseConfig.xml: this is the new Config.xml file, but it must not be changed. Consider your changes lost if you ignore this warning.
  • MediaPaths.xml: this file determines where the official Data Sources are found, including DLC if owned.
  • Config.xml_disabled: generated after the first launch of the game, this file is the old Config.xml file that has been disabled. If you had precious information stored in Config.xml before the update, you can find it back here.

If you have any modifications that you'd like to load into Spintires, then you may create a file called UserMediaPaths.xml within the [Spintires/User] directory. This file will never be removed or altered by Steam or us. The content of UserMediaPaths.xml should follow the same format as in MediaPaths.xml, for example:

<DataSources>
<MediaPath Path="MyMod" />
</DataSources>

We've introduced this new method to prevent issues where the game would not notice installed DLCs. You can also set-up additional asset sources without the risks of losing their configuration with the next update or DLC install.

As some of you know, over the years we’ve occasionally travelled a rocky road with a few obstacles being thrown in our path along the way. Last Friday, another obstacle presented itself which, whilst it doesn’t affect existing customers in any way, it will prevent new customers from purchasing Spintires temporarily.

Spintires has been removed from the Steam platform by an unverified individual from Russia who has filed a DMCA notice via Valve. Although the takedown is not based on any substantiated legal grounds, unfortunately, the takedown process means that all notices are accepted at face value and games removed almost automatically. The system doesn’t verify the legitimacy of the claims, nor does it verify the individuals behind such claims before removing the game from the platform. The system merely relies on a “declaration” form and honesty. No doubt that whoever filed the takedown was aware of this automatic removal process. Steam are being supportive, and we are working to get Spintires put back up for sale as soon as possible.

Dynamic weather.



Finally, it's raining in Spintires, a dynamic weather system has been included with various rates of downpours and howling winds that sweep across the harsh-lands in a randomised manner. Watch as leaves and dust blow across the screen!

This is the first iteration of the dynamic weather system and more improvements are to arrive at a later date. Upcoming improvements include, mud becoming more difficult to traverse when wet, rain bounce effects and vehicles becoming wet. 

Sound system overhaul.

Often neglected by game studios in this industry; audio has a very important role in any video game since the sound design is what truly convinces the mind that it is in a place; in other words "hearing is believing".

That's why we revisited the sound system and gave it an overhaul. It's time to say goodbye to sounds being forced through a single channel, you'll now experience a rich and wide audio environment with birds singing your left ear and V8 petrol monsters screaming in your right ear!

The vehicle audio is now handled differently too, based on RPM and engine load. When you climb a hill, you'll hear a deeper engine tone as the engine struggles to output your request. It truly adds a more dynamic and immersive experience, hear for yourself...

  • Added stereo audio support
  • Added reverb audio effects (minimalistic).
  • Added listener cone.
  • Added the second iteration of vehicle audio system (including engine fan, twin-turbo system and engine onload and offload sounds).
  • Added the second iteration of vehicle sounds (stereo)(recorded from YaMZ-238 V8 Diesel, KamAZ-740 V8, Kharkiv model V-2 V12, 2.1L Gaz 69, ZIL-375YA 7.0l V8 Petrol).
  • Added stereo ambient/interaction sounds.
  • Added basic PTO winch simulation (activating the winch strains the truck's engine like powered constraints).

Free-roam Camera.



More of a debug feature for map makers and videographers; we've now added a free-roam camera, activated by pressing F2 in-game.

You can use the mouse and mouse wheel to move around, or the number pad arrows.

  • 2,4,6,8 (numberpad) -- Moves camera.
  • 5 (numberpad) -- Tracks the truck (toggle)
  • -/+ (numberpad) -- Moves camera up and down.
  • 0 (numberpad) -- Slow camera movement (toggle).
